While many may envision a basic electrician handling family circuitry and standard repair work, there exists a specific cadre of professionals within the electrical trade, typically referred to as Level 2 Electricians. These highly competent people have an unique set of credentials and obligations, allowing them to work straight on the service network, connecting homes to the wider electrical grid.
Becoming a Level 2 Electrician is not a simple endeavor. It needs a considerable investment in training, experience, and a dedication to strenuous security standards. Typically, an individual would first finish a standard electrical apprenticeship, gaining foundational understanding and useful skills. Following this, striving Level 2 professionals need to undertake even more, highly specialized training certified by energy authorities. This sophisticated coursework delves into the intricacies of overhead and underground service lines, metering equipment, and the elaborate procedures for linking and disconnecting power at the point of supply. The curriculum highlights a deep understanding of the network's facilities, consisting of poles, pillars, and street lighting, and the safe treatments for here dealing with live electrical apparatus. Practical evaluations and composed evaluations are essential to this process, ensuring that candidates have not only theoretical understanding but also the hands-on efficiency to perform their responsibilities safely and properly.
The daily life of a Level 2 Electrician is far from routine. Their work frequently includes critical tasks that straight impact the circulation of electrical energy to homes and businesses. This can consist of installing new service lines to connect freshly built residential or commercial properties, upgrading existing connections to accommodate increased power needs, or moving service lines for numerous factors, such as renovations or facilities jobs. They are likewise the experts called upon to perform vital maintenance on the network, troubleshoot complex faults that lie beyond a consumer's meter box, and respond to emergency situations like power interruptions or harmed service lines. Their proficiency encompasses detaching and reconnecting power for upkeep, repairs, or security reasons, always sticking to stringent security protocols to protect both themselves and the general public.
One of the defining attributes of a Level 2 Electrician's function is the direct interaction with the electrical supply network. Unlike basic electricians who mainly deal with the customer side of the meter, Level 2 specialists are authorized to deal with the "supply side." This includes jobs such as fixing damaged service cables, installing or replacing private poles, and updating mains power. Their understanding of metering is likewise vital, as they are often responsible for setting up, getting rid of, or testing electricity meters, making sure accurate billing and efficient energy management. This proximity to the high-voltage network necessitates an unrivaled dedication to security. Every job performed is thoroughly planned and performed with adherence to stringent standards and regulations to alleviate the intrinsic threats related to live electrical energy.
